Description

The Dirty Donut is the first event of its kind to be held on dirt roads.  This event has 6 different distances of 4, 16, 26, 42, 62, and 100 miles.  Everyone from the very serious racer to those that just want a fun riding experience have a place at this event.  Serious racers will opt for the “Sprint” race, which is conducted much like any other gravel race and the winners are the first to finish.  “Donut” racers will opt for a bit more strategy in a race where the winner is often not the fastest rider, but the rider who can combine speed with how many donuts they can eat.  In the Donut races, each race distance has “donut stops” positioned along the race route.  Participants deduct five minutes from their final finish time for each donut they consume at one of our “donut stops” in the race.  The great thing about this race is that there are several different ways for competitors at all levels of cycling fitness to become winners.  The Dirty Donut Race is a family fun event and is truly “A Race for All of Us”.

Sound like fun? It all takes place on Saturday, June 20, 2026. The race will start and finish at the Martin High School in Martin, Michigan.  A very beautiful high quality medal will be presented to every racer that finishes and we have even more hardware for our divisional and age division winners!  As part of their entry each racer will get an event t-shirt and most of the field will get a free BBQ lunch based on when they registered and which race distance they entered.
